> i want to make a note, > > if anyone tries to register that freeverb dll file, you will have serious > troubles... > > if you are running xp, and you wonder why on earth you cannot see the plug > in, it is because the batch file points to c colon back slash windows back > slash system and not the system32 folder. > > you had better re-name the path by ending the system with a number 32, and > then you will be golden. > > re-name the activate files with a dot txt extension, and open it with note > pad, put the number 32 at the end of the system part, and things will go > like they should. > > definitely do remember to re-name them back to just dot bat, before you try > to run them... > > i ran mine from the command prompt but, you may be able to run the batch > from the windows view... > > i am surprised the person that sent me the file did not pick up on this very > important fact. > > > Roger R.
